THE Warmer Worcestershire Network has received funding from the National Grid Warm Homes Fund to provide 150 first time gas central heating systems.
To be eligible for the funding, there must be no existing central heating at the applicant’s property (some old night storage heaters may be eligible), the property must be in an area near to a mains gas supply, and be privately owned (improvements to social housing cannot be funded).
To meet the application criteria, the Householder/tenant must also be in receipt of qualifying benefits or must pass a low income high energy cost assessment.
Private landlords can apply for 50 per cent funding towards the cost of a first time gas central heating system. In addition to the eligibility criteria above, the property must have an existing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ating in a band A – E.
Installations of the gas central heating systems are subject to technical survey by an appointed contractor and gas transporter.
